WebStretch. Simple stretches can relieve muscle tension and help you realign your posture. Try the shoulder roll: Sit or stand comfortably. As you inhale, raise your shoulders to your ears. As you exhale, pull your shoulder blades down and together. Do this five or 10 times in a row, a few times a day. Don't sit still. A student is considered in good standing if they maintain a cumulative KU GPA of 2.00 or better. If a student falls below a KU cumulative GPA of 2.00, they are considered on probation. If it is a student's first semester below a KU cumulative GPA of 2.00, they will be placed On Notice for that semester.
